Output 7482379d72fe693e33bd7c8cd4a48c9b1654457483c8b67c7bda28e6aaba2072:49

value
54414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52b7bea052cf53f47513e762810aa2c28f185131 OP_EQUAL
address
39EPT5HxqfBKLP6BoJL4Dm93GffPeC5gfA
transaction
7482379d72fe693e33bd7c8cd4a48c9b1654457483c8b67c7bda28e6aaba2072
spent
true